A newborn is listless and has a heart rate of 50 beats per minute after 30 seconds of stimulation. You should? FIRST:
A) initiate positive pressure ventilation.
B) begin chest compressions.
C) obtain IV access.
D) apply the AED.
Ans: A) initiate positive pressure ventilation.
